channel.m
来自「多径信道误码率计算」· M 代码 · 共 22 行
M
22 行
%信道幅频响应
%Design filter by specifying delay in units and
%looking at mag and phase response
%Good deafult values for fft_size = 128 and num_carriers = 32
delay_1 = 6; % 6
attenuation_1 = 0.35; % 0.35
delay_2 = 10; % 10
attenuation_2 = 0.30; % 0.30
num=[1,zeros(1,delay_1-1),attenuation_1,zeros(1,delay_2-delay_1-1),attenuation_2];
[H,W]=freqz(num,1,512); % compute frequency response
mag=20*log10(abs(H)); % magnitude in dB
phase=angle(H)*180/pi; % phase angle in degrees
figure(9),clf
subplot(211),plot(W/(2*pi),mag)
title('多径信道幅度响应')
xlabel('数字频率'),ylabel('幅度 dB')
subplot(212),plot(W/(2*pi),phase)
title('多径信道相位响应')
xlabel('数字频率'),ylabel('相位度数')
break
⌨️ 快捷键说明
复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?